Editorial Summary

Arizer V Tower and Utillian 722 are both electronic / convection vaporizers, but they target different priorities. Arizer V Tower is usually the lower-cost pick at $88, around $82 below Utillian 722. Utillian 722 has the quicker listed heat-up profile, which can matter for shorter sessions.

Comparison FAQs

What is the biggest difference between the Arizer V Tower and the Utillian 722?

The biggest practical difference is form factor: these aren't the same kind of device. Arizer V Tower is a desktop, Utillian 722 is a portable. Pick based on whether you want something portable or something stationary.

Which is cheaper, the Arizer V Tower or the Utillian 722?

Arizer V Tower is the cheaper option at $88 compared with $170 for the Utillian 722, about $82 less. Live retailer pricing can shift, so confirm before buying.

Which heats up faster, the Arizer V Tower or the Utillian 722?

Utillian 722 reaches session-ready temperature in ~30 seconds, while the Arizer V Tower takes 1-2 minutes. That's roughly 60 seconds quicker on the Utillian 722, which is useful if you want shorter, on-demand sessions.

Does the Arizer V Tower or the Utillian 722 hold more flower?

Arizer V Tower has the larger chamber at ~0.7g, versus <0.4 grams on the Utillian 722. A bigger bowl means fewer reloads on long sessions; a smaller one suits microdosing and quicker bowls.

Which is lighter, the Arizer V Tower or the Utillian 722?

Utillian 722 is the lighter unit at 180g, around 248g less than the Arizer V Tower at 428g. The lighter device is easier to carry and pocket day-to-day.

Is the Arizer V Tower or the Utillian 722 better for home versus on-the-go use?

Utillian 722 is the take-anywhere choice. It's a portable, battery-powered unit, while the Arizer V Tower is built for home use, where bigger heaters, AC power, and larger chambers make sense.
